ABOUT THE COURSE
A one-day course to help participants develop an understanding of how to manage common palliative care symptoms and palliative care emergencies.
WHAT WILL I LEARN?
By the end of the session, participants will be able to:
- Understand the importance of a good assessment
- Explore management/treatment options for common symptoms including nausea and vomiting and agitation and delirium
- Recognise what constitutes a palliative care emergency and how to manage them
WHO SHOULD ATTEND?
This course is aimed at Band 5/6 staff nurses.
